Radners famously misguided Emily Litella character, the hearing-challenged Weekend Update commentator, was inspired by the real- life live-in nanny, Elizabeth Clementine Gillies, known as Dibby, who helped raise Radner and her brother. [1] The protagonists of the sketch are Lisa Loopner (played by Gilda Radner) and Todd DiLaMuca (played by Bill Murray), whose reparte with one another would be the focus of the sketch,[1][2] and regular character Mrs. Enid Loopner (played by Jane Curtin), Lisa's mother, in whose home the sketches were usually set.
